nits panel

This panel is part of the Settings Dialogue. It allows you to control what nits are reported, and how.

Output verbosity

All nits with a lower priority that Output verbosity are ignored.

Output file format

You can chose your preferred format of nit output, either the predefined HTML, SPEC, TEST, TEXT, or XHTML, or select an output format definition of your own by chosing bespoke and selecting the file in the template file field. Examples of templates can be found in the source.

individual nit severity

SSC can produce many different nits, at many different severities. You may disagree with SSC’s default severity, so you can change it here. Select the nit from the list box, then select your preferred nit level from the radio buttons below.

checkboxen

output nit IDs

Nit ids are used to control particular nits from the command line, and in testing. If you might want to use them, select Output nit ids.

do not repeat nits

In certain circumstances, certain nits may be repeated. The repeated nits may contain additional information, but also can produce a lot of extra low value output. If you do not wish to see these repeats, on the same problematic piece of code, then select do not repeat nits.